Abstract

The embodiment of the invention discloses a kind of air conditioning control method, device, air-conditioning equipment and storage mediums, this method comprises: obtaining the voice messaging for controlling air-conditioning;It determines the identity information of user according to the voice messaging, and the control instruction for controlling air-conditioning is determined according to the voice messaging and the corresponding identity information of the voice messaging;The thermoregulative mechanism for controlling air-conditioning executes the control instruction.The air-conditioning of the prior art is solved the problems, such as there are voice control accuracy rate is lower, has reached the technical effect for improving air-conditioning voice control accuracy rate.

Embodiment one
Fig. 1 is the flow chart for the air conditioning control method that the embodiment of the present invention one provides.The technical solution of the present embodiment is applicable in In pass through voice control air-conditioning the case where.This method can be executed by air conditioning control device provided in an embodiment of the present invention, should Device can be realized by the way of software and/or hardware, and configure and apply in air-conditioning processor.This method specifically include as Lower step:
S101, voice messaging for controlling air-conditioning is obtained.
When user needs through voice control air-conditioning, the voice messaging comprising control command is said towards air-conditioning.It can be with Understand, the air-conditioning of the present embodiment is provided with microphone.The control mechanism of air-conditioning acquires language from the user by microphone Message breath.
S102, the identity information that user is determined according to voice messaging, and according to voice messaging and the voice messaging pair The identity information answered determines the control instruction for controlling air-conditioning.
After the control mechanism of air-conditioning gets voice messaging, the identity information of user is first determined according to voice messaging, with And the corresponding control command of the voice messaging, then determined according to the identity information and control command for controlling air-conditioning work Control instruction.
Wherein, the airconditioning control effect that control command is directly stated for the voice messaging of user, such as sleep pattern, dehumidifier Mode, temperature adjustment is to 25 degree etc., and control instruction is the instruction that control mechanism is used to control thermoregulative mechanism operation, and thermoregulative mechanism is existing There are thermoregulation mechanism of the air-conditioning of technology, such as compressor etc..
Preferably for the determination of identity information, airconditioning control mechanism first extracts the voiceprint of voice messaging, then root The identity information of user is determined according to the voiceprint.Determination for control command, airconditioning control mechanism usually require to extract language The semantic information of message breath, then determines control command according to the semantic information.It should be noted that the present embodiment is not to vocal print Information extraction algorithm and Semantic features extraction algorithm are defined, as long as accurate vocal print letter can be extracted from voice messaging Breath.
It is understood that due to the difference of constitution, everyone is not identical to the difference of control model, and therefore, this reality It applies example and is preferably based on the corresponding relationship that machine learning is established between subscriber identity information and control model.Then according to the body of user The determining preferred control model of corresponding relationship between part information and subscriber identity information and control model, and according to The control model and control command generate control instruction.
Further, if active user is new user, control mechanism determines user according to the voiceprint of voice messaging Age, control command is determined according to the semantic information of voice messaging, it is then corresponding according to control command and the age of user Recommendation control model generate control instruction.In addition, when the history voice messaging according to user determines its preference control model, Age of user participates in the training of model as a weight parameter.
In addition, the present embodiment, which can also use when typing mode, i.e. user's typing vocal print, is arranged preference pattern, control mechanism Just the voiceprint of user and preference pattern are bound, i.e., bound identity information and preference pattern.Control mechanism is true in this way After having determined the corresponding identity information of voice messaging, preference pattern corresponding to the identity information has also been determined that, then basis should Preference pattern and the corresponding control command of voice messaging generate control instruction.
S103, the thermoregulative mechanism for controlling air-conditioning execute control instruction.
After generating control instruction, i.e. the thermoregulative mechanism of control air-conditioning executes the control instruction, so that air-conditioning exports and should The corresponding air-flow of control instruction.
Wherein, thermoregulative mechanism is the thermoregulative mechanism, such as compressor of air-conditioning etc. of the prior art.
Illustratively, for air-conditioning after use after a period of time, control mechanism extracts the voiceprint of voice messaging, Then the user corresponding to according to voiceprint to it is identified, such as No. 1, No. 2 etc., while analyzing each voiceprint pair The control command in voice messaging answered, so that it is determined that the control model that each voiceprint is preferred.In this way when user A towards Air-conditioning says " the temperature was then adjusted to 25 degree ".The control mechanism of air-conditioning acquires the voice messaging by microphone, and then basis should The voiceprint of voice messaging determines its owning user A, control command be the temperature was then adjusted to 25 degree, inquiry voiceprint with it is inclined The preference pattern of the corresponding relationship discovery user A of good model is drying mode, then is generated according to the preference pattern and control command Control instruction;Then thermoregulative mechanism is controlled according to control instruction and executes temperature adjustment work, so that air-conditioning is worked with drying mode, and defeated Temperature is 25 degree out.
Illustratively, user child B says the temperature was then adjusted to 24 degree this air-conditioning, and control mechanism analyzes voice letter The voiceprint of breath is the discovery that the voice messaging that a child issues, and control command is the temperature was then adjusted to 24 degree, then basis should The recommendation pattern and control command of age bracket generate control instruction, and the thermoregulative mechanism for controlling air-conditioning executes the control instruction, with Export the air-flow for being suitble to child.
The technical solution of air conditioning control method provided in an embodiment of the present invention, including obtaining the voice letter for controlling air-conditioning Breath;The identity information of user is determined according to voice messaging, and is believed according to voice messaging and the corresponding identity of the voice messaging Breath determines the control instruction for controlling air-conditioning;Control air-conditioning thermoregulative mechanism execute control instruction, so as to avoid according only to Control command controls the unexpected adjusting that thermoregulative mechanism carries out temperature adjustment and occurs, and greatly improves the accuracy of voice control air-conditioning And the experience of user.
